Встраиваемый таймер из 6 деталей » Программирование устройств на PIC микроконтроллерах


Логин:
Пароль:
О сайте:

Pic.Rkniga.ru - Сайт как для начинающих, так и для опытных радиолюбителей, разрабатывающих свои устройства на популярных PIC микроконтроллерах.
Здесь можно обмениваться сообщениями на форуме, а также добавлять на сайт статьи и схемы своих устройств.

Меню сайта
Главная Форум по PIC микроконтроллерам Форум Статьи по PIC микроконтроллерам Статьи Справочная информаци по PIC микроконтроллерам Справочник Литература по PIC микроконтроллерам Литература Схемотехника Схемотехника устройств на PIC микроконтроллерах Микроконтроллеры Программаторы Все по программированию PIC микроконтроллеров Программы, Софт Программы Ссылки
Опрос

Какие микроконтроллеры вы используете?


Atmel
MicroChip
STM
Motorola
Texas Instruments
Другие


Последние материалы
  • Тестовая плата для отладки программ на микроконтроллере PIC18F4550
  • Кнопка On/OFF на PIC12F629.
  • Часы с синхронизацией от китайского будильника
  • ШИМ регулятор на PIC16F628A.
  • Счетчики прямого и обратного счета на PIC16F628A.
  • Таймер отключения питания для мультиметра и не только.
  • Измеритель напряжения и тока
  • Маршрутный компьютер для электровелосипеда
  • Простой двухканальный термометр на PIC16F690 и датчиках DS18B20
  • Электронная "Незабудка" для забывчивых
  • Популярные материалы
    Случайная книга
    Встраиваемый таймер из 6 деталей
    Автор публикации: alex Просмотров: 6997 Добавлен: 24-07-2012, 22:39 Комментарии: 0

         Сегодня никого не удивишь конструкцией таймера, т.к. в продаже и в интернете подобных устройств как грибов за баней. И все таймеры с любого бока как пасхальные яйца похожи друг на друга. Посмотрев несколько схем я так и не нашла подходящего проекта, который мог бы удовлетворить мои потребности. А мне нужна была мечта диверсанта – удобный часовой механизм. Как это не банально, у моей потребности причина была крайне обыденна, мне нужен был таймер для организации процесса экспонирования сухого пленочного фоторезиста. Для этих целей был получен в подарок «убитый» сканер, приобретены компактные ультрафиолетовые дискотечные BLB лампы и арматура к ним со встроенными электронными балластами. Т.к. навыка работы с фоторезистом у меня нет, а теория предписывает постановку многократных экспериментов для отработки технологии и достижения качественного результата, что требовало от меня таймера, который отвечает следующим параметрам:
    – компактная конструкция и простая схемотехника;
    – минимальное и достаточное кнопочное управление;
    – задание времени с точностью до секунды;
    – функция паузы с выключением нагрузки;
    – функция сброса времени.
    Все поставленные задачи были реализованы в этом проекте.
    Схема

         В устройстве два равнозначных управляющих выхода, сигнал одного из них инвертирован. Это сделано в целях более удобного сопряжения со схемами управления исполнительных устройств, которые здесь не рассматриваются.
         Время задается кнопками «больше»-«меньше». Максимальное время 99 минут 59 секунд. Для ускорения установки времени реализован программный автомат скорости ввода значения пока непрерывно нажата любая из кнопок «больше»-«меньше»: медленный посекундный ввод, затем ускорение ввода единиц секунд и, наконец, ускорение ввода десятков секунд.
         Кнопкой «старт/пауза» стартуем таймер, о чем свидетельствует обратный отсчет на индикаторе. Пока таймер тикает, кнопки «больше»-«меньше» заблокированы. Повторное нажатие на «старт» ставит таймер в «паузу». Кнопка «сброс» сбрасывает время и останавливает процесс.
         Индикатор имеет 10 знакомест. Каждое знакоместо состоит из 7 сегментов с точкой. Время таймера выводится на пять знакомест, на оставшееся место выводится фраза в зависимости от текущего состояния:
    Встраиваемый таймер из 6 деталей

    Встраиваемый таймер из 6 деталей

         «НОУ» (типа НЕТ) – таймер остановлен и лампа выключена;
         «УЕС» (типа ДА) – таймер тикает и лампа светит.
         Более вразумительных фраз составить на семисегментных индикаторах мне не удалось. Если будут идеи по поводу фраз, то я их с радостью реализую. В связи с тем, что схема очень проста, рисунок печатной не предлагаю, оставив для вас немного поля для творчества.

    Файлы в архиве:
    Схема в формате S-Plan
    Прошивка для МК

    vstraivaemiitaimer.rar [4,34 Kb] (cкачиваний: 325)

    Категория: Часы-Таймеры, PIC16
    « Назад
    Комментарии